buying advice for new compact
 
Hey guys..

My first post here....

I am lookking to buy a new compact digital camera to replace my trusty old fuji finepix f710 which I've for about 6 years. Its getting a little bit outdated now (altho it still takes a nice pic, but low resolution)

I have a budget of upto around £200, but dont mind spending a little more if needs must.

I want a decent all rounder, for taking portraits / family shots holiday pics and quick shots of the pets

I've been searching the web looking at reviews but im getting a bit confuzzled.....theres loads more to choose from now then when I bought my last one.

I've been drawn towards the lumix TZ / canon powershot range, but then someone else will say go for a nikon of a fuji.

I'm not too bothered about video recording, but would like something with decent picture resolution, decent optical zoom (dont need anything huge tho) facial recognition, and something that is quite good in low light....

Any recomendations ?
thanks alot

The TZ and PowerShot are indeed excellent camera lines.
However, for both good optical zoom and good low light image quality,
I strongly recommend Sony's Cyber-shot HX5. It's a great camera,
with various cool features and high image quality.
It's currently sold by amazon.co.uk for £189.
